  1. In calculating the cumulative exposure dose to lockdown, we assigned a weighting of 3 to days with Level I response, 2 to days with Level II response, 1 to days with Level III response, and 0 to other days
  2. PTB preterm birth, MPTB moderate preterm birth, VPTB very preterm birth
  3. N/A: There is no VPTB case in the subgroup
  4. *: Adjusted for maternal age, marital status, parity, residential city, delivery type and infant sex
  5. a Pregnant women who have experienced the COVID-19 lockdown (from 1/23/2020 to 2/24/2020) during any period of their pregnancy were defined as the exposed group. We further divided the exposed group into subgroups. According to their gestational weeks (GW) on 1/23/2020, the beginning of lockdown
  6. b: The exposed group refers to the pregnant women who have experienced the COVID-19 lockdown in their first 22 GWs. The rest of included participants were defined as the unexposed group. The individual cumulative exposure dose was calculated by combining the weightings with the overlap between their pregnancy period ≤22 GWs and the three levels of responses. Q1-Q4 were defined as the cumulative exposure dose of the exposed group classified by quartiles, and the unexposed group were used as reference
